Church of St Swithin and the London Stone, Cannon Street, City of London, c1830. Said to be the spot from which the Romans measured all distances in Britannia, the London Stone is an ancient oolite stone that was set into the wall of St Swithin's Church. The church was destroyed in a German bombing raid during the Second World War but the Stone was left unscathed.
